The Herald Group Names Advocacy Industry Leader Becky Boles to Serve as Chief Client Services Officer

WASHINGTON, D.C. – April 3, 2025 – The Herald Group is pleased to announce Becky Boles' appointment as the firm’s Chief Client Services Officer. In this newly created position, Boles will serve on the organization’s leadership team and work across key practice areas, staff levels, and client accounts.

Becky is a communications and public affairs veteran with more than two decades of experience advising and leading issue management campaigns for Fortune 100 companies, industry trade associations, and non-profit organizations. She has also established and led industry-leading training and capabilities development programs within agency environments to advance the professional skills of both experienced and young professionals.

“We are thrilled to welcome Becky to The Herald Group team,” said Matt Well co-founder of The Herald Group. “Her knowledge and experience will be instrumental as we continue to grow at a rapid pace and help us to more creatively and effectively service our clients moving forward.”

“In today’s fast-paced communications landscape, success isn’t just about groundbreaking ideas—it’s about having the right talent, strong client partnerships, and the infrastructure to execute. I’m excited to join The Herald Group to strengthen our team, deepen client relationships, and optimize our processes for lasting, scalable growth.” – Becky Boles

During her career, Becky has led global teams supporting large corporations and organizations, including McDonald’s, Verizon, Dow Chemical, Lenovo, Bechtel, Rosetta Stone, and SC Johnson. Before establishing her own boutique public affairs firm in 2021, Becky held several executive positions in the U.S. and in the European Union at leading global PR and digital communication firms, including Weber Shandwick, Golin, APCO Worldwide and CRAFT.
